  • Good fund - solid returns - partly because they invested more heavily into tech / biz services over last decade
  • Comp - seems in line with UK MM... 
  • Progression - actually seems reasonable from what I hear - enough space / lean enough to move up the ranks
  • Risk - heard one / two of the Partners leaving to setup own fund - but that's because they did well (or so I understand rather than related to Synova itself...)
 

Culture - not sure, worked a few years ago with one of the Partners there when I was sell-side - he was not easy to deal with. Curious to hear more of what you heard? 

I do think they have been fortunate with growth being aligned to what did well in the last decade. Although, frankly, I don't think its much different to an Inflexion or Livingbridge in terms of strategy.
